Across TCGA patient cohorts, ATP6V0D2 RNA expression is significantly associated with the protein abundance of many other proteins, with 10,856 significant associations in total. GBM sh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ible ATP6V0D2-associated proteins across cancer lineages are ACP5, GPNMB, and DMXL2. Each is linked with ATP6V0D2 in more than 6 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both ATP6V0D2-to-partner and partner-to-ATP6V0D2 results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, ATP6V0D2 versus ACP5 in CCRCC, with a Pearson correlation of 0.58.
